Description
The Thatched Cottage is a 17th and 18th century building located on Bridge Road in North Warnborough. It has one storey and an attic, featuring irregular window arrangements. The structure has a timber frame, which is exposed in the gable, and is clad in red brickwork arranged in Monk bond. The roof is thatched, with a tiled section around a small gabled dormer, and there is a tiled roof with a tile-hung half gable on the western outshot. The ground-floor openings are cambered, and the windows are square-leaded casements. The entrance features a plain door.
